Web11 de mar. de 2024 · This air-raid shelter was the center of the Third Reich’s government from January 16, 1945, when Hitler retreated into the bunker. It was used until Mai 2nd 1945, when General Helmuth Weidling, commander of the Berlin Defense Area, surrendered to General Chuikov of the Soviet Army. WebEverything came to head on Sunday, April 22nd. During a three-hour military conference in the Führerbunker, Hitler let loose a shrieking denunciation of the German Army and the "universal treason, corruption, lies and failures" of all those who had let him down.
